Everything You Need for Groomed Brows
My sister and I were recently discussing how brows don't seem terribly important in your teens and twenties, but the need to care for them grows as you age. I generally use "Divaderme" on my brows. It is a mixture of clay and thousands of tiny fibers which adhere to your brows and make them look like your own. Even though I love this product, I am still fickle and bought Too Faced's "Brow Envy Brow Shaping and Defining Kit" a few months ago. For $35.00, it's a great deal, especially if you are unsure of what to do with your brows. The kit includes two blendable brow powders (blonde and brunette), a small brow pencil, three plastic brow stencils, a valuable step-by-step guide, two mini-brushes, and a small pair of tweezers. Mix the brow powders for the perfect color (since my hair is auburn, this isn't always easy, but Too Faced makes it handy for me to do). Use the brushes to apply wax and brush brows upward and outward for a manicured, wide-awake look. I don't need the stencils (I have had plenty of eyebrow training in modeling school and afterward), but I do use everything else. No matter how much you love this kit, please be sure to toss after nine months to a year. I will Probably Have This Forever
This is a great eyebrow kit. It comes with a template that is very easy to use. It also has illustrations to help guide you. There is a wax to keep your brows set, although I don't use it because it removes the color I just put on. The colors are good, and I blend them to get the best color. A little, little bit of the powder is all you need. The more I use them, it seems like I haven't even used it! The powder really stays on my brows, probably because I apply moisturizer also to my brows. This is a worthwhile kit.
